1967 Suzuki T200/X-5 Invader sales brochure (8 pages). Click to enlarge. The last page with the specification is in Italian and the rest is in English. I'm not sure if the last page belongs to the same sales brochure. At least the last page is printed in Japan, February 1966.

1967 Suzuki T200 Invader sales brochure from USA (2 pages). Click to enlarge. I found these scans on Ebay. There's no date mentioned, I believe the leaflet was produced for the '67 season. Printed in Japan
